Output ef26d4705e617d94daf723eb99aa40ce778e86a3e7e7d2964ac5534f95b8214a:122

value
456971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 190e4816d62e2b8ac003c0d5ea6d11bfaa074a00 OP_EQUAL
address
33yVveDC3emLmsMjg8MscNCWedWS3x3aaT
transaction
ef26d4705e617d94daf723eb99aa40ce778e86a3e7e7d2964ac5534f95b8214a
spent
true